Mark Teixeira Returns to Yankees Lineup

Mark Teixeira has officially been cleared to rejoin the Yankees lineup. Teixeira has missed about a month with a Grade 1 left calf strain.

"I feel a lot better," Teixeira said. "Really good week in Tampa, very productive. We accomplished everything that we wanted to accomplish."

Mark Teixeira will be batting fifth for the Yankees on Monday and will be playing first base as well.

Yankees Clinch 2012 Postseason Berth

The Yankees are officially in the postseason in 2012.

With the Rangers win over the Angels, the Yankees have clinched a postseason berth. The Yankees have been in the postseason in every season starting from 1995, besides 2008.

The Yankees and Orioles are currently tied for first place in the American League East division.

The Yankees were able to salvage the final game of their four game set on Sunday after they defeat the Blue Jays 9-6. The Yankees were down 5-1 at one point, but came all the way back to win the game.

Phil Hughes started for the Yankees and he departed quickly. Hughes allowed 5 runs on 8 hits in 4 2/3 innings of work. He struck out 4 and walked 2. He exited the game after throwing 93 pitches, in which 60 of them were for strikes.

The Yankee offense came alive in the later innings as they scored 7 runs in the seventh inning and beyond. They had a big seventh inning when they scored three runs to tie the game at 5. The Yankees would later take the lead in the eighth inning when Eduardo Nunez would hit a sacrifice fly to score Curtis Granderson. They would take one more on in the inning on a Derek Jeter RBI single. Curtis Granderson would give the Yankees some insurance in the ninth inning when he drilled a two-run single to increase their lead to 9-5.

Rafael Soriano would come on in the ninth to get some work in. He would allowed 1 run on 1 hit.

The Yankees will return home and will begin a three game set with the Red Sox to conclude their regular season.
